I love the Beverly Hills Car Club site.  Lots of good photos of sorry-looking cars.  The descriptions are very upbeat but somehow fail to mention how rusted or burned to a crisp the car may actually be.  Also, in case you're wondering, they are not a club, but a dealer that's not even located in Beverly Hills.  Every once in a while I trawl through their site for reference pictures.  Last time I checked there appeared to be quite a stock of E-Types in their inventory.

 

Here are some of the pics I've saved.  This is a '62 Series I Flat Floor Roadster.  Note the patina...
